Excerpt from The Fruit Situation, Vol. 133: October 1959 Exports of fresh oranges continued heavier during the past summer than in the summer of 1958. Total exports of fresh oranges and tangerines (mostly oranges) during November 1958-august 1959 were the equivalent of more than 6 million boxes, 37 percent larger than exports in the same months of 1957-58. But exports of orange juice were smaller. Canned single-strength orange juice was million gallons, down 29 percent; canned concentrated orange juice, h78,000 gallons, down 56 percent; and frozen concentrated orange juice, 3 million gallons, down 12 percent. Over the same 10 months, imports of fresh oranges were about boxes, up 37 percent. Arrivals were particularly large during May, June and July. During these months prices were the highest since last fall and available supplies in Florida were decreasing with the approach of the end of the season.
